Travel Group Recommends ways to increase Tourism
|
|
Improve travel infrastructure and ease visa processing among ideas suggested by regional travel group
|
According to the Pacific Asia Travel Association, regional countries need to invest in transportation infrastructure to stimulate tourism. In the wake of the economic crisis, Asian countries have increased tourism promotion, but such efforts will be wasted the association says, if tourists are not able to reach their destination because of poor transportation within a country. Improvement of road networks is seen as vital in this regard. Other considerations that affect tourism, according to the group, are economic liberalization, socio-political stability, visa requirements, travel taxes, documentation, customs and health regulations and regulations at borders and other points of entry. The report stressed the importance between balancing the incoming flow of tourists as against the need for procedures to control the flow, the association said. Measures to promote tourism, which the association wished to see adopted are: the granting of visas on arrival, adopting a simplified, machine-readable visa form, using the Internet for accepting visa applications and payment and increasing the amount of currency let into the country.
